Introduction of the TCF Test
The TCF is developed by the French Ministry of Education and is widely recognized by institutions and companies that need proof of French language proficiency. The test evaluates candidates in a number of areas, including listening comprehension, reading comprehension, spoken expression, and written expression.

The online registration process for the TCF test generally follows a series of simple steps. Here is a comprehensive guide:
Step-by-Step Registration Process
Choose the Right Platform: The initial step is to check out the official website of the organization administering the Order TCF Certificate test in your region, such as France Education International (FEI) or your local French cultural center.
Select Your Test Date: Review the available test dates and choose one that finest fits your schedule.
Produce an Account: If you are a newbie registrant, develop an account on the platform. You will need to offer personal details, such as your name, date of birth, email address, and possibly your nationality.
Complete the Registration Form: Fill in the registration type with the needed details, including your picked test center, test date, and any special accommodations you might require.
Submit Identification Documents: Most registration platforms will require you to publish a legitimate identification document (passport, national ID, and so on). Guarantee the file is clear and readable.
Payment: Proceed to the payment area. The costs for the TCF test may vary by place and company, so be prepared to pay online by means of credit/debit card or other accepted payment methods.
Verification: After finishing the payment, you will get a confirmation email with your registration details. Keep this e-mail for your records.
Get ready for the Test: Utilize the time before your test date to study and practice. Numerous platforms offer main practice materials, sample questions, and ideas for success.

What is the cost of the TCF test?
The cost varies by area and test center. Typically, costs range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 200. Examine the particular website for accurate prices.
2. How long does it take to get test results?
Outcomes are typically available within 2 to 4 weeks after the test date. Candidates will receive a certificate that information their scores and efficiency level.
3. Can I alter my test date after registration?
The majority of test centers enable candidates to alter their test dates, however it typically includes a charge. Inspect the specific policies of your testing center.
4. What files do I need for registration?
You will usually require a legitimate ID (passport or national ID) and perhaps additional paperwork depending on your location.
5. Is the TCF test readily available online?
While the registration procedure is online, the TCF Test Purchase test itself is normally carried out in-person at authorized testing centers.
